#ifndef SYN_ENCODER_H
#define SYN_ENCODER_H
#include "../common/syn_defs.h"
#include "../drivers/syn_gpio.h"
#include "../dsp/syn_signal.h"
#include <stdbool.h>
#ifdef __cplusplus
extern "C" {
#endif
/* ── Encoder direction ──────────────────────────────────────────────────── */
typedef enum {
SYN_ENCODER_NONE = 0,
SYN_ENCODER_CW = 1,
SYN_ENCODER_CCW = -1,
} SYN_EncoderDir;
/* ── Encoder descriptor ─────────────────────────────────────────────────── */
typedef struct {
SYN_GPIO_Pin pin_a;
SYN_GPIO_Pin pin_b;
int32_t position;
int32_t delta;
uint8_t last_state;
int8_t last_dir;
/* Optional: step multiplier (for encoders with detents every N states) */
uint8_t steps_per_detent;
int8_t sub_count;
/* Statistics (optional) */
SYN_Signal *stats;
} SYN_Encoder;
/* ── API ────────────────────────────────────────────────────────────────── */
void syn_encoder_init(SYN_Encoder *enc, SYN_GPIO_Pin pin_a, SYN_GPIO_Pin pin_b);
void syn_encoder_set_steps_per_detent(SYN_Encoder *enc, uint8_t spd);
void syn_encoder_update(SYN_Encoder *enc);
int32_t syn_encoder_get_delta(SYN_Encoder *enc);
static inline int32_t syn_encoder_position(const SYN_Encoder *enc)
{
return enc->position;
}
static inline void syn_encoder_set_position(SYN_Encoder *enc, int32_t pos)
{
enc->position = pos;
}
static inline SYN_EncoderDir syn_encoder_direction(const SYN_Encoder *enc)
{
return (SYN_EncoderDir)enc->last_dir;
}
void syn_encoder_set_stats(SYN_Encoder *enc, SYN_Signal *stats);
#ifdef __cplusplus
}
#endif
#endif /* SYN_ENCODER_H */
